The Problem: Your Wallet is a Physical and Postural Burden

The issue is simple physics. When you sit down with a thick wallet in your back pocket, it creates a significant imbalance. Your pelvis, the foundation of your spine, is tilted to one side to accommodate the object. This subtle, continuous shift can cause a chain reaction up your entire back. This is a condition known as "Wallet Sciatica" or "Fat Wallet Syndrome."

This is not just an anecdote — an article in PMC titled Credit Carditis or Fat Wallet Syndrome outlines how prolonged sitting on a large wallet can lead to low back pain, radiating pain in the lower extremities, confirming that the condition popularly known as wallet sciatica has a clinical basis. The pressure from the wallet can compress the sciatic nerve, which runs from your lower back down your legs. This compression can lead to a host of symptoms:

  • Chronic Lower Back Pain: The most common symptom, often felt as a persistent ache on one side.

  • Sciatic Pain: Sharp, shooting pain that radiates from your hip down your leg.

  • Numbness or Tingling: A sensation of pins and needles in your leg or foot.

  • Poor Posture: Your body subconsciously tries to compensate for the imbalance, leading you to hunch or lean to one side, which strains your muscles and ligaments.

Here’s how a minimalist carry helps your back and posture:

  1. Eliminates the Imbalance: By moving your wallet to your front pocket, you remove the source of the postural tilt, allowing your spine to remain in its natural, aligned position while sitting.

  2. Reduces Pressure: There is no longer any direct, sustained pressure on your sciatic nerve or the surrounding muscles in your glutes.
